Case Notes

These guys are bozos. I sent the following letter to them:

"Yes I know this is a random, unsolicited piece of email but
you might actually be interested in what it has to say."

You are wrong. Remove [MY EMAIL] from any of your
mailing lists and let me know that you have received this email.
If I do not receive a response, I will lodge a complaint with your
ISP and then the Internic. In addition to being rude and a violation
of netiquette, mass email spammings are also illegal:

[QUOTED LEGAL CODE]
I received the following reply from root (who apparently was the spammer):

Your hateful acknowledgement has been read, and your name has been removed
from our lists.

1. Email "spammings" are not illegal, as recently demonstrated by court
rulings against America Online.

2. U.S. laws apply to U.S. companies. This is not a U.S. company.

3. GET A LIFE!!

My reply was:

>Your hateful acknowledgement has been read, and your name has been removed
>from our lists.

Good.

>1. Email "spammings" are not illegal, as recently demonstrated 
>by court rulings against America Online.

The courts have not made a decision yet on that case as it has
not gone to trial. 

>2. U.S. laws apply to U.S. companies. This is not a U.S. company.

If US laws do not, internet ethics should.

>3. GET A LIFE!!
Try developing some professionalism.

Here are three sites that maintain lists of users who do not
want to receive unsolicited mail. They will remove those addresses
from your email lists as a free service. Maybe that will stop
more mean people from sending you hateful mail.

And the final conclusion of this saga is their response:

I actually wanted to thank you for this - I had no knowledge of these lists,
and will apply them immediately. Sorry for the continued communication, but
I wanted to let you know that your efforts are appreciated.
